Output 6b97d3aa86caf2133bf3bf97ca04318d776ddd64cb3d6ea4faa18503ec5bf446:0

value
583684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24d2c60fed10df356069f9e3d6a99d0a483e013c OP_EQUALVERIFY OP_CHECKSIG
address
14MhpieDCZCfYpn9tfHy3yQSWYXXcf9ogu
transaction
6b97d3aa86caf2133bf3bf97ca04318d776ddd64cb3d6ea4faa18503ec5bf446
confirmations
1615
spent
true